		<description><![CDATA[During a simple home repair project, Eva is planning on putting two coats of paint on her dining room. After the second coat of paint dries, she intends to hang up a picture of her family in the room. The activity relationships described in this example are known as:

A. Soft logic
B. Lag
C. Mandatory dependencies
D. Critical path

Answer: C. Mandatory dependencies
When you have activities that inherently require other activities to be completed, they are called mandatory dependencies, or hard logic. Discretionary dependencies, or soft logic, allow some flexibility and is based on preference. In this example, Eva must finish her first coat of paint before applying the second coat of paint. Then she must wait for the second coat of paint to dry before she can hang up her picture; she does not have any flexibility on the dependencies.]]></description>

		<description><![CDATA[An output of a scope process that links requirements to their origin is called:

A. WBS dictionary
B. Requirements traceability matrix
C. Scope baseline
D. Requirements documentation

Answer: B. Requirements traceability matrix
The requirements traceability matrix, an output of the Collect Requirements process, helps ensure that each requirement adds business value by linking it to the business and project objectives (PMBOK®).]]></description>

		<description><![CDATA[Projects and operations have similarities and differences. Which of following is true?

A. Projects are performed by teams, operations are performed by individuals
B. Projects are temporary, operations are ongoing
C. Projects are planned, operations are executed
D. Projects are limited by constraints, operations are not

Answer: B. Projects are temporary, operations are ongoing
Projects and operations are both performed by teams, are both planned, executed, and monitored and controlled, and are both limited by constraints. However, projects must have an end and operations will not.]]></description>

		<description><![CDATA[Part of your project includes the construction of a new room and although it is not your company's core competency, you decide to perform a make-or-buy analysis. After you conduct your due diligence and make your decision, you will be creating a request for proposal. Which process are you working on?

A. Plan Procurements
B. Select Sellers
C. Conduct Procurements
D. Plan Contracting

Answer: A. Plan Procurements
The four current processes in the procurement knowledge area are Plan Procurements, Conduct Procurements, Administer Procurements, and Close Procurements. Make-or-buy decisions and procurement documents, such as a request for proposal, are performed in the Plan Procurements process.]]></description>

		<description><![CDATA[While monitoring and controlling risks on a project, one of the tools a project manager could use compares the amount of the contingency reserves remaining to the amount of risk remaining to determine if the remaining reserve is adequate. This is called:

A. Reserve analysis
B. Performance report
C. Risk audit
D. Variance and trend analysis

Answer: A. Reserve analysis
A reserve analysis is used in parallel to project execution since risks may have positive or negative impacts to the contingency reserve. This ensures that the reserve is neither too high nor too low throughout the project.]]></description>

		<description><![CDATA[As a senior project manager, Jim is asked to review the work of other project managers in the organization. Wendy, a fairly new project manager, is working with her team to sequence activities. One thing Jim should ensure is that Wendy has already performed the __________ process.

A. Develop Schedule
B. Estimate Activity Resources
C. Define Activities
D. Estimate Activity Durations

Answer: C. Define Activities
Although all of the choices are time management processes, only the Define Activities process precedes the Sequence Activities process. The primary output of Define Activities is an activity list, which a project manager must obviously have in order to sequence activities.]]></description>

		<description><![CDATA[Your project team currently consists of you and three others. If you add one more individual to the team, making a total of five people, how many more communication channels will you have?

A. 3
B. 4
C. 6
D. 10

Answer: B. 4
Communication channels are calculated by n(n-1)/2. That means, if you have four people (like the example), you have six channels [4(4-1)/2 = 4(3)/2 = 12/2 = 6]. Alternatively, you can simply draw four dots on a page and draw a line from each dot to every other dot. That may be a challenge if you have, say, a forty person team. Anyway, the question asks for how many more channels. Therefore, if four people have six channels and five people have ten channels, the difference is four.]]></description>

		<description><![CDATA[Which of the following estimating types provides the most accuracy?

A. Parametric
B. Analogous
C. Bottom-up
D. Top-down

Answer: C. Bottom-up
Bottom-up estimating, which may also be called grass roots, engineering, or definitive estimating, will provide the most accuracy since activities are estimated with the greatest level of detail. However, that level of accuracy comes at a cost. In order to be more accurate than parametric and analogous, it will also take the longest amount of time to create.]]></description>
